Description

Mr Rahim Gjoka commissioned Allen Archaeology Limited to undertake archaeological strip, map and recording in advance of the installation of a new car wash. The machine excavation of two tank pits measuring 2.0m x 1.2m and c.0.6m deep were monitored and recorded. No archaeological deposits or features of significance were observed. Planning ID: S/2020/2382/FUL
